The Standards Committee of Islington Council met on Monday 14 September 2026 to discuss the committee's membership, terms of reference, and meeting dates for the upcoming year, as well as to consider a proposal for general dispensations under the Code of Conduct. The meeting also included a review of the minutes from the previous meeting.

Membership, Terms of Reference and Dates of Meetings

The committee was scheduled to consider its membership, terms of reference, and meeting dates for the municipal year 2026-27. This agenda item, detailed in the Public reports pack 14th-Sep-2026 19.00 Standards Committee, aimed to ensure the committee was properly constituted and its members were informed. According to the report, councils are required to establish a Standards Committee as part of an ethical framework, as mandated by the Local Government Act 2000. The committee's role includes advising on a local Code of Conduct, hearing cases on potential breaches, and considering complaints. The report outlined the proposed membership for 2026-27, which included Labour councillors Troy Gallagher (Chair), Nurullah Turan, and Shreya Nanda, alongside Green councillors Caroline Allen and Benali Hamdache. Independent persons Rachael Tiffen and Yemi Mustapha were to attend as non-voting observers. The scheduled meeting dates for the year were also listed as 14 September 2026 and 11 November 2026.

General Dispensations under the Code of Conduct

A significant item on the agenda was the proposal to grant a general dispensation to all councillors under the Code of Conduct. This matter, outlined in the Public reports pack 14th-Sep-2026 19.00 Standards Committee, aimed to allow councillors to participate in discussions and voting on certain matters where they might have a disclosable interest. The report explained that Section 31(4) of the Localism Act 2011 restricts participation in matters where a councillor has a disclosable pecuniary interest, but Section 33 allows for dispensations if certain criteria are met. These criteria include situations where the number of prohibited participants would impede the transaction of business, alter the representation of political groups, or if granting the dispensation is in the interests of local residents. The report proposed renewing a set of general dispensations previously agreed, covering areas such as housing, school meals, allowances, council tax, rent levels, housing benefit, adult social care, and non-domestic rates. A specific point was made regarding trade union membership, where it was argued that without a dispensation, the transaction of business would be impeded due to the high proportion of members belonging to trade unions. The recommendation was to grant this dispensation with effect until 13 September 2030.

Minutes of the Last Meeting

The committee was also scheduled to review and agree the minutes from its previous meeting, which took place on 20 November 2025. The minutes, included in the Public reports pack 14th-Sep-2026 19.00 Standards Committee, indicated that the previous meeting had discussed an Annual Report on Member Standards and Conduct. This report had highlighted lower attendance at training sessions and noted that several complaints did not constitute a breach of the Code of Conduct. The minutes also mentioned consideration of proposed changes to the standards regime by the government.
